The Clothesline Project is a long-standing tradition at BGSU in partnership with The Cocoon. Throughout the week of 4/6 - 4/10 you can view the Clothesline Project on the CWGE Facebook @bgsu.cwge and join #BGSUVirtual to bring awareness and support survivors of domestic and sexual violence. Creating a t-shirt to contribute to the Clothesline Project is a positive way to explore personal experiences, unpack trauma, and find support through advocacy. #BGSUSAAM2020 Although this can be helpful and healing for survivors, the exhibit may be triggering. BGSU’s Active Learning Classrooms (ALC) are specially designed spaces that bring together pedagogy, design elements, and technology to help faculty fully engage students in the pursuit of learning. In order to help faculty make the best use of these classrooms, the CFE is pleased to present an ALC Certificate after completing the 2 part series. Part 1 will focus on active learning strategies and discuss how those strategies can be put to use in their classes.
